RC Lens coach Franck Haise played down talk of his side qualifying for Europe after Saturday’s 2-1 win at Angers SCO kept them clear in second place in the Ligue 1 Uber Eats table.

Goals from Wesley Saïd and Facundo Medina helped Lens to victory at the Stade Raymond-Kopa on Saturday as they moved to within two points of leaders Paris Saint-Germain and opened up a six-point gap on the chasing pack ahead of Sunday’s matches.

“Obviously when you have 33 points at this stage of the season you can start to say that a European place is accessible,” said Haise after Lens made it four consecutive wins in the top flight for the first time since 2001.

“We are going to do everything we can to improve our points total. Last year we got five points more (than the previous season). If we get five more points this year then we should get into Europe,” added Haise, whose side have now lost just one of their last 22 Ligue 1 games.

“But the squad is really focused on our performances each weekend. We are not getting carried away. There is lots of ambition in the squad but we know it all comes down to hard work.”

Lens have one more game before the interruption for the World Cup, with Clermont Foot 63 visiting the Stade Bollaert-Delelis next weekend.
